Requirements
(For Filipino Citizens studying in the Philippines)
FILIPINO CITIZENS
Apply for admission via https://apply.shs-adc.edu.ph/. Digital copies of the below requirements are to be uploaded during the online application process. Once the student receives a Notice of Acceptance, the original documents MUST be submitted to the Office of the School Registrar prior to confirmation of enrolment.
ADMISSION REQUIREMENTS for NURSERY 1, NURSERY 2 and KINDER FILIPINO CITIZENS
- PSA Birth Certificate
- 2×2 most recent picture with white background (upload .jpg or .png file)
ADMISSION REQUIREMENTS for GRADE 1 to GRADE 11 FILIPINO CITIZENS
- PSA birth certificate
- Latest grades of the current grade level. (Upon enrollment, the original and final report card MUST be submitted to the Office of the Registrar.)
- Final report card of last completed grade level
- 2×2 most recent picture with white background (upload .jpg or .png file)

ADMISSION PROCESS
(For Filipino Citizens studying in the Philippines)
FILIPINO CITIZENS
Thank you once again for choosing Sacred Heart School – Ateneo de Cebu for your child. We are pleased to inform you that the admission for S.Y. 2026-2027 is now open. Below is an easy guide to our application process.
ADMISSION PROCESS
STEP 1
Create an account using our online admission portal: https://apply.shs-adc.edu.ph/
STEP 2
Review requirements here: https://shs-adc.edu.ph/admissions/. Please prepare the scanned or digital copies of these requirements in advance since you will need to upload them later during the application process. Kindly ensure that the copies are clear.
STEP 3
When ready, you may start the application process by filling in the online form. Upload the required documents as per the nationality of the child. You may add additional applicants to the same account.
STEP 4
Pay the application fee of PHP 700 per child, via bank transfer or cash onsite at the Finance office. Upload the payment confirmation under the Application Fee section in the admissions portal.
STEP 5
Admission team will review your application after payment is validated by Finance. If the application received falls on a weekend, it will be reviewed the next working day. Please ensure to upload correct and complete documents.
STEP 6
Once reviewed, book your child’s onsite entrance exam/assessment via the admissions portal.
STEP 7
Come to school with the test permit and proceed to the Testing Services on your assigned date to take the entrance exam/assessment. Please call 09339710690 for further assistance.
STEP 8
The results will be available within 5 working days. All applicants for Senior High School will have an additional interview at the Principal’s Office. You will be notified via email if your application has been accepted or rejected.
STEP 9
If accepted, then a Big Congratulations Indeed! You may proceed to pay the reservation fee of PHP8,000 per child within 15 days of acceptance. The reservation fee is non-refundable but deductible from the overall tuition fee. Payments can be made via bank transfer or at the cashier counter onsite.
STEP 10
For all accepted applicants, official enrollment will begin in May 11, 2026 to June 6, 2026. Enrollment instructions will be sent via email in May 2026. You will need to submit the original documents to the School Registrar and pay the tuition fees at the Finance Office to be officially enrolled for S.Y. 2026-2027.
